Solar Radiation Data in 32127

Based on historical 32127 data, solar panels that are tilted towards the equator at an angle equal to the latitude will produce the maximum solar energy output in 32127. [1]

The region associated with 32127 has an average monthly Global Horizontal Irradiance (GHI) of 4.92 kilowatt hours per square meter per day (kWh/m2/day), which is approximately 3% greater than the average monthly Direct Normal Irradiance (DNI) of 4.77 kWh/m2/day. [1]

Solar installations in 32127 that are always titled at the latitude of Port Orange (Average Tilt at Latitude or ATaL) average 5.44 kWh/m2/day, or about 11% greater than the average monthly GHI of 4.92 kWh/m2/day and approximately 14% greater than the average monthly DNI of 4.77 kWh/m2/day. [1]

Solar Energy Glossary

Global Horizontal Irradiance (GHI)

Global Horizontal Irradiance: The total amount of solar radiation that is received per unit area by a surface that is always positioned in a horizontal manner.

Direct Normal Irradiance (DNI)

Direct Normal Irradiance: The total amount of solar radiation received per unit area by a surface that is always perpendicular to the sun rays that come in a straight line from the direction of the sun at its current position in the sky.

Average Tilt at Latitude (ATaL)

Average Tilt at Latitude: The total amount of solar radiation received per unit area by a surface that is tilted toward the equator at an angle equal to the current latitude. ATaL will often produce the optimum energy output.

Solar Radiation Analysis for 32127

Solar Radiation Data in 32127

The region associated with 32127 has a average annual solar radiation value of 5.59 kilowatt hours per square meter per day (kWh/m2/day). [1]

The month with the highest historical solar radition values in 32127 is April with an average of 6.25 kWh/m2/day, followed by March at 6.09 kWh/m2/day and May at 5.91 kWh/m2/day. [1]

The three months that historically average the lowest average solar radiation levels in 32127 are December with an average of 5.05 kWh/m2/day, followed by June with an average of 5.23 kWh/m2/day and July at 5.26 kWh/m2/day. [1]

Solar Output Analysis for 32127

Solar Radiation Data in 32127

32127 has a average annual solar AC output value of 6159.13 kilowatt hours (AC). [2]

The month with the highest historical solar power output in 32127 is March with an average of 575.73 kWhac, followed by April at 564.69 kWhac and May at 546.86 kWhac. [2]

The three months that historically average the lowest average solar output levels in 32127 are June with an average of 463.37 kWhac, followed by February with an average of 478.82 kWhac and July at 482.68 kWhac. [2]
